摘要
本文给出了单跨度转子柔性碰摩数学模型并建立起柔性碰摩实验,利用实验对比了转子在无碰摩和有柔性碰摩下的动力学特性。通过实验分析发现在有无柔性碰摩下存在着许多不同的振动特性。发现了柔性碰摩除了提高转子的临界转速外,还能有效降低转子通过临界转速时的振动幅值;有效地抑制油膜涡动的形成和油膜振荡的发生,同时出现了较为明显的高频振动现象。
